Plummeting Newspaper Ad Revenue Sparks New Wave of Changes

With global newspaper print advertising on pace for worst decline since recession, publishers cut costs and restructure. Global spending on newspaper print ads is expected to decline 8.7% to $52.6 billion in 2016.
